General Conditions
Habla Ya Spanish School accepts no responsibility whatsoever for students' actions.
The Spanish School is not responsible for any personal items left in the school building, accommodation, volunteering partners, transportation and/or third party companies.
On formalizing enrollment into a Spanish course (and accommodation) students accept the General and Payment Conditions and Payment Method, as well as the norms, rules and guarantees of Habla Ya Spanish School.
We strongly recommend that all students take out a travel or medical insurance policy in their home countries. Habla Ya Spanish School will not be held liable and is not responsible for any accident or injury held within our outside our facilities during your Spanish Program.
If students are participating in any tour or excursion they have responsibility to ensure that their travel or medical insurance policy covers the activity or sport in which they are participating.
In the case of a serious disciplinary offence, repeated bad behavior or infringement of the laws of Panama, the student will be expelled from the school and accommodation contracted with Habla Ya Spanish School without the right to any refund.
In the case were damages are caused to third parties, all the expenses claimed from Habla Ya Spanish School that originate from the above-mentioned incident will be charged to the student, who will have no right to later claims.
Habla Ya Spanish School reserves the right to use all photos and video footage taken during the student's stay unless the student refuses permission in writing.
General Info
All requests for refunds must be submitted in writing to the school.
Habla Ya Spanish School will refund money to the students if, due to the fault of the institution the student cannot take classes with the signed professor at the set up timetable and as long as students prefer to not reschedule.
No refunds are available for classes lost due to local holidays but students are encouraged to reschedule those lessons without any further charge.
When Habla Ya Spanish School organizes an excursion at a time and date when students have lessons, and they would like to attend, the School Director will inform if rescheduling of lessons is possible without further cost or if lesson will be lost if students decide to assist.
No refund is available for those students who live in Panama and for any reason cannot finish their course. A full credit representing classes not taken will be given and can be used when a course for them can once again be arranged.
There will be no partial refunds for days of class, home stay or other type of accommodation or excursions missed by personal reasons, nor will the student be able to make them up at a later date.
Credits will expire in one year time. If the student wishes to transfer the credit to a friend, workmate or parent, he or she should write us a letter letting us know the specific person to whom grant the credit.
Flexibility of class schedule
Private lessons can be held in the schedule of your preference as long as teacher availability is determined by the School Director.
If a student is going to miss a private lesson, he should communicate this situation to the School Director with at least 24 hours of anticipation of the Spanish lesson. Otherwise, the student looses those hours of instruction. The best way to do so is through an email to the teacher and School Director or a phone call to the school.
For group lessons, the schedule is arranged by the Administration of the school. This schedule will be set taking into account students needs and teacher and classroom availability.
If students who have group lessons miss a class, they will loose those hours of instruction no matter what.
As a gesture of good manners, civility and politeness, teachers always appreciate if students inform them about their planned/unplanned absences.
